CVE-2026-24486 Python-Multipart has Arbitrary File Write via Non-Default Configuration
Python-Multipart is a streaming multipart parser for Python. Prior to version 0.0.22, a Path Traversal vulnerability exists when using non-default configuration options UPLOADDIR and UPLOADKEEPFILENAME=True. An attacker can write uploaded files to arbitrary locations on the filesystem by crafting...

tar: Tar path traversal
A flaw was found in GNU Tar.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by providing two specially crafted TAR archives, if those archives were extracted in the same directory.
